Dead fish along a remote volcanic lake. A rumble from below the water. A violent splash. Then, according to the expedition leader, enormous blue luminous hemispheres appeared across the far shore.

English-language summaries often reduce Kalygir to a single line: Russian biologist Valery Dvuzhilny saw a disc land near the bottom of a 90-metre-deep lake. The more detailed narrative is different, stranger and much harder to classify.
In August 1980 a small expedition reached Lake Bolshoy Kalygir on Kamchatka's remote east coast. The team was reportedly following up an older story about an intense blue-white light seen near the lake decades earlier.
On 7 August, Dvuzhilny later said, the expedition found numerous dead or badly affected fish along part of the shoreline. He reportedly checked radiation with a dosimeter and found only normal background levels.
That night the team heard a powerful rumble that seemed to come from below the water. A blue flash followed, then a violent splash and large waves crossing the lake. Afterward, Dvuzhilny described a yellow point becoming a large blue luminous hemisphere above the far shore, with the sequence repeating several times.
Geologist Igor Solovyev later said he encountered an intense blue-white light near a flooded cave at the lake. This is a separate event and should not be treated as automatic corroboration of 1980.
Solovyev reportedly wrote to the Soviet popular-science magazine Tekhnika-Molodezhi. The publication helped motivate later interest in the site.

In a later interview Dvuzhilny summarised the experience as a strange disc landing near a deep lake bottom. That phrasing became the dominant English-language version even though the fuller account describes a more complex water-and-light event.
The expedition reportedly found dead and badly affected fish along one section of the lake. Later versions describe whitened eyes, swollen bodies or spines, and live fish behaving abnormally. Dvuzhilny said a radiation check was normal.
That combination is unusual enough to matter. It is also exactly where source discipline becomes essential. No laboratory pathology, water chemistry, specimen record or instrument log has yet surfaced in the current research trail.
Without those records, the fish kill cannot be used as proof that an unknown energy source affected the lake. It remains a reported environmental anomaly that needs contemporary documentation.
The most distinctive part of the account is not a metallic craft. It is a sequence of water disturbance and repeated luminosity.
Dvuzhilny also described an intense, almost animal fear during the episode. That is part of the testimony, but it is subjective evidence and cannot establish the nature of the phenomenon.
Lake Bolshoy Kalygir sits in one of the world's most volcanically and seismically active regions. A sublacustrine gas release, underwater slump, seiche or other geological disturbance is therefore a serious candidate for the reported rumble, splash, waves and fish mortality.
A natural event also fits the normal radiation reading: a violent water disturbance does not need to be radioactive. Fish kills can follow oxygen depletion, gas release, thermal change, toxic chemistry or other environmental stressors.
The hardest element for a simple one-off geological explanation is the reported repeated luminous hemisphere. Earthquake lights, gas-discharge luminescence or optical effects can be proposed, but the current case file does not contain a demonstrated mechanism matching the reported size, shape and repetition.
“A strange disc landing near a 90-metre-deep lake bottom.” It is vivid, simple and easy to repeat — which is why it dominates many English retellings.
Dead fish, a normal dosimeter reading, a bottom-origin rumble, blue flash, large splash and waves, followed by repeated blue luminous hemispheres near the opposite shore.
That difference is not cosmetic. It changes the case from a straightforward “saucer landing” story into an unresolved question about testimony, translation and a potentially unusual environmental event.
Kalygir still belongs in the archive because the fuller account is more substantial than the thin English one-liner — but also less cleanly “UFO-shaped.”
If the original expedition record confirms multiple witnesses, the fish anomaly, the water displacement and the repeated luminous domes, the case becomes a genuinely intriguing environmental/UAP event.
If those details weaken as the source chain gets closer to 1980, then the famous underwater-saucer story may prove to be a product of translation, compression and later interpretation.
